According to the Myers-Briggs typology model (MBTI), I have an attitude preference for introversion (as opposed to extraversion). This is true if I look at my behaviour. To most, I seem outward going and always interactive with people around me and I do not disagree with the perception. However, I do need my quiet time away, from everything and everyone to recharge. It is important for me to have meaningful engagements, but when I don't give enough time and space to myself, to think and reflect my energy levels suffer. I am flat at best and I get overwhelmed by even the smallest commitments that lie ahead.
